Ogilvy Africa has appointed internationally experienced communications professional Delna Sethna as chief creative officer. She will head the creative offering for group’s Sub-Saharan Africa network from its Nairobi office starting the first of August. Sethna has more than twenty years’ experience in the creative and marketing space. She comes to Ogilvy from Red Fuse Communications, also part of the WPP group.

Sethna served as executive creative director at WPP/Redfuse, where – among her other successes – she helped to relaunch the Palmolive brand to the Indian market. After working as a filmmaker in the early part of her career, Sethna entered the marketing sphere, where she rose rapidly through the ranks at several leading agencies, including Lowe, JWT & Burnett and Saatchi & Saatchi.
Accolades
Among the creative accolades she has received have been at Cannes, D&AD, the #FemvertisingAwards, Spikes, Kyoorius and the Effies. She has also served on many industry awards juries and has been listed among the women who have changed the face of media. She was named among India’s 50 Most Influential Women for two years in a row.
